GANNI IS LOOKING FOR A NEW ALLOCATOR READY TO JOIN AS SOON AS POSSIBLE. IF YOU THRIVE IN AN INTERNATIONAL ENVIRONMENT AND EXCEL IN STOCK MANAGEMENT AND ANALYSIS, APPLY NOW TO BE PART OF OUR TEAM

YOUR MISSION & RESPONSIBILITIES AHEAD OF YOU
You will be a part of a small team based in Paris and you will report to the Allocation Manager. Working in a highly international context, you will be responsible for stock allocation, sales planning and maintaining the optimum stock levels by store. Specifically, those are tasks ahead of you:

Stock Management and Allocation:

  • Planning stock allocation for each store and ECOM.
  • Work closely with all departments in planning and maintaining optimum stock levels.
  • Maintaining stock accuracy on in-house systems across all channels.
  • Lead on all in-season stock replenishment for Retail and Web stores.
  • Propose and implement inter-store transfers and movement of stock to achieve optimal stock balances.
  • Liaising closely with warehouses, stores and other Head Office departments
  • Monitor and ensure recommended size ratios are maintained across styles
  • Work on re-allocating stock between business channels depending on business needs.

Reporting and analyses:

  • Produce daily, Weekly and Monthly sales report
  • Prepare and distribute Monday Packs (Sales by line) for management
  • Propose analysis of store category performance and propose changes to Stock levels/Ranges
  • Continual contact with stores (main point of contact in Head Office).
  • Reporting set-up: Standardize, optimize, and automate weekly reporting.

MUST HAVE REQUIREMENTS

  • Strong user of Excel and tech-savvy
  • Strong organizational skills
  • Strong numerical and analytical skills
  • A passion for the world of fashion
  • Previous experience in a similar role
